 Food and Memories of Abruzzo: Italy's Pastoral Land " A culinary gem for everyone who wants to bring the true flavor of Italy into their home." – Paula Wolfert, author of Mediterranean Cooking Anna Teresa Callen grew up in Abruzzo, one of Italy’ s most striking regions. In this wonderful, evocative book, she unveils the secrets of Abruzzo’ s robust culinary traditions. Here is simple cooking at its best, with flavors kept fresh and clean. The 350 recipes range from elaborate festival dishes– including the region’ s signature dish, Maccheroni alla Chitarra– to uncomplicated rustic fare. Anna Teresa Callen (New York, NY) is an accomplished food writer, teacher, food consultant, and television personality. Two of her shows, Let Them Eat Pasta! and Nature’ s Masterpiece, The Egg, have aired nationwide on CBS and PBS, and her articles have appeared in Bon Appé tit, Gourmet, the New York Times, and other publications.
Dotch Cooking Show - The Dotch Cooking Show (ã©ã£ã¡ã®æ–™ç†ã‚·ãƒ§ãƒ¼; dotch no ryori show) (April 17, 1997 - March 17, 2005) was a Japanese cooking show aired by the Yomiuri Telecasting Corporation known for its use of highest quality and most expensive food ingredients. The show is replaced by the New Dotch Cooking Show (æ–°ã©ã£ã¡ã®æ–™ç†ã‚·ãƒ§ãƒ¼; shin dotch no ryori show) from April 14, 2005. Cooking show - A TV cooking show is a television program that presents the preparation of food, in a kitchen on the studio set. The host of the show, usually a celebrity chef, prepares one or more dishes over the course of the show, taking the viewing audience through the food's preparation showing all intermediate stages of cooking.
